Envista Holdings Corporation Buyer/Planner in Pomona, California

Job Description:

The Buyer Planner will plan, release and manage production work orders and purchase orders to fulfill production requirements. Position will also be responsible for monitoring and managing assigned value streams and planner codes including inventory and customer service levels. Will also be responsible for planning finished goods inventory levels for distribution.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Releases and manages production requisitions in accordance with Heijunka level loading, kanban signals, production plan goals and related planning data.

  • Places and manages purchases orders in accordance with MRP, Kanban signals, production plan goals and related planning data.

  • Works closely with manufacturing and suppliers to prioritize, expedite and de-expedite work orders and purchase orders based on material availability, department resources, changing requirements and customer service requirements.

  • Manage the assigned value streams including the management of inventory turns improvement, backorder reduction and coordinating activities with other planner buyers and departments.

  • Participates in the new product development process and supports supply chain planning activities at the new product team level.

  • Manage, monitor and update Kanbans for assigned value streams and production cells.

  • Have strong working knowledge and apply the principles of planning/pull system.

  • Have an understanding of lean manufacturing.

  • Manage and maintain inventory levels to the company goals at the raw, sub-assembly, WIP and finished good levels.

  • Monitors and understands key planning parameters such as safety stocks, buffer stocks and lot sizes.

  • Works closely with vendors to manage and control product lines, to prioritize, expedite and assure enough material supply to support customer demand.

Envista is a global family of more than 30 trusted dental brands, united by a shared purpose: to partner with professionals to improve lives. Envista helps its customers deliver the best possible patient care through industry-leading dental consumables, solutions, technology, and services. Our comprehensive portfolio, including dental implants and treatment options, orthodontics, and digital imaging technologies, covers an estimated 90% of dentists' clinical needs for diagnosing, treating, and preventing dental conditions as well as improving the aesthetics of the human smile. Envista companies, including DEXIS, Kerr, Nobel Biocare and Ormco, partner with dental professionals to help them deliver the best possible patient care.

Envista became an independent company in 2019. We brought with us the proven Envista Business System (EBS) methodology, an experienced leadership team, and a strong culture grounded in continuous improvement, commitment to innovation, and deep customer focus to meet the end-to-end needs of dental professionals worldwide. Envista is now one of the largest global dental products companies, with significant market positions in some of the most attractive segments of the dental products industry.
